  12. In Revision When an order is In Revision it means the buyer requires the seller to revise the delivery to fit the requirements sent. The seller is prompted to deliver again and both users are encouraged to communicate on the order page to sort out any issues with the delivery. As a buyer, you will see a message to indicate that revisions were requested to the seller on the progress bar. The order is paused and the funds are held by Fiverr until the order is marked as "completed." If the seller is unresponsive, you can always use the Resolution Center to request an order update from the seller. As a seller, you will see a message prompt to deliver again. We encourage sellers to make sure all the buyer's concerns are addressed, and if any questions arise on the seller's end, ask the buyer for clarification before the delivery is sent again. Note: Even though the order timer keeps ticking down after the order is marked as "rejected", the seller is not timed on delivering the revisions. The on-time delivery statistic only measures the first delivery made on the order.
